About Lance Allred
Lance Collin Allred (born February 2, 1981) is an American former professional basketball player, who was the first deaf player to play an NBA game. Allred is legally deaf, with 75%–80% hearing loss due to Rh complications at birth. He is also an inspirational speaker and author, with his first book, Longshot: The Adventures of a Deaf Fundamentalist Mormon Kid and His Journey to the NBA, published by HarperCollins in 2009.
